| Top Skaters from Philippines introduced graceful
figure skating to Chiangmai people at Bully Sky Ice May 20 & 21, 2000 LPI |
|||
Finally, the top 3 skaters made thier way to Chiangmai on May 19, 2000 for the first figure skating show in Chianmai with a big support from SM Group of Manila, Philippines. The show is held 3 times on May 10 and 20. Due to the rainy weather, the crowd was rather small on the first day. (Major transportation for young people are motor bikes which may limit their activities on the rainy days.) However, the weather turned out better on the 2nd day and lot of people enjoyed the show. On the second day of the show after the skaters had a good night sleep, skaters became more relaxed and enjoyed performing in the show. After each show, three skaters stayed on the ice and helped local skaters ice skating (left photo). Mr. Ric Camaligan, Vice President of ISI Asia and Assistant Vice President of SM Leisure Group, also stayed at the ice rink almost all day long to utilize his time productively to help the growth of ice skating in Chiangmai. Skaters Profile |
|||
![]() |
Michael Gregory Novales Started ice skating at age 11. Joined the SM Formal Lessons and after only 3 years, Mike reaped a total of 57 gold, 12 silver and 3 bronze medals and honored with numerous special awards by local and international competitions. |

Irina Feleo Irina is best in artistic interpretation and exudes excellent grace in delegate ice skating recitals. She is an upcoming star of Philippine Ice Skating. A girl to watch especially in solo and was cited numerous special awards for artistic interpretation. She is Philippines best bet for movie stardom being the child of famous Philippine movie stars. |

Dale Marcus Feliciano A Physical Therapy college student who hope to be a successful skating instructor in the future is an excellent skater. A performer who moves best in artistic expressions and back it up with technical abilities. Dale started skating already in his teens, built up his solid expertise in joining international and local competitions where he always gives out his best. Dale is currently working on his FS10 and given the break might just be the 2nd Pilipino who can handle the difficult level. Dale has a total medal haul of 27 gold and 7 silver medals. |
